wingbot
Version:
Enterprise Messaging Bot Conversation Engine
22 lines (16 loc) • 438 B
JavaScript
/*
* @author David Menger
*/
;
const Router = require('../Router');
function expectedInput ({ type = null, confident = false }, { isLastIndex }) {
return (req, res) => {
if (confident) {
res.expectedConfidentInput(type);
} else if (type) {
res.expectedInput(type);
}
return isLastIndex ? Router.END : Router.CONTINUE;
};
}
module.exports = expectedInput;